Hilarious story about her. When John's mission was about to begin, Lyndon Johnson wanted to get a photo-op comforting Ann in her living room as John lifted off. She wouldn't let him in, and John backed her up from the launch pad.
It was always assumed she didn't want him to come in with his photograpers because she had a bad stutter, and didn't want to look bad on camera.
Later she said her stutter didn't have anything to do with it. It was a really bad headache that had been with her for several days keeping her awake at night. She just didn't want to deal with the VP under those circumstances.
